Output 3fba986b4a8cfcc7df0308881fdea5255bfb6da73dfd1b8a15db2813f46ad3d4:0

value
995638
script pubkey
OP_0 OP_PUSHBYTES_20 0528c52e3e8aeab51eef70ef82754af749f7ce2c
address
bc1qq55v2t373t4t28h0wrhcya227ayl0n3vkl0p3y
transaction
3fba986b4a8cfcc7df0308881fdea5255bfb6da73dfd1b8a15db2813f46ad3d4
confirmations
86525
spent
true